
Istanbul Van Bus Services
The Istanbul–Van bus route is one of Turkey’s longest intercity travel routes, connecting the Marmara region to the Eastern Anatolia region.
The total distance between the two cities is approximately 1,600 kilometers, and the journey takes around 24 to 26 hours by bus.
Several companies operate daily services throughout the day and night.
Traveling from Istanbul to Van by bus is comfortable and safe thanks to modern vehicles and professional drivers.
Most buses travel via Bolu, Ankara, Kayseri, Malatya, and Bitlis.

Istanbul Van Bus Departure and Arrival Points
Buses from Istanbul to Van depart from both the European and Asian sides of the city, offering flexibility for passengers.
Departure Points in Istanbul:
- Esenler Bus Terminal (European Side)
- Alibeyköy Bus Station
- Dudullu Terminal (Asian Side)
- Harem Bus Station
Arrival Points in Van:
- Van Intercity Bus Terminal
- Erciş, Muradiye, Gevaş, Tatvan (for some companies)
Some companies also provide free shuttle services from the terminal to Van Yüzüncü Yıl University or the city center.

How Long Is the Istanbul Van Bus Journey
The Istanbul–Van bus journey takes around 24 to 26 hours, depending on the route, rest stops, and traffic conditions.
Most buses follow the Bolu – Ankara – Kayseri – Malatya – Tatvan – Van route.
There are typically four or five rest stops during the trip.
